Asphaltite and Asfaltita

Asphaltite, also known as asfaltita in Spanish, is really a In a natural way developing strong bitumen. This is a hydrocarbon-dependent mineral that forms from your biodegradation of petroleum in excess of extensive durations. Asphaltite is often black, brittle, and extremely viscous, making it distinct from softer petroleum items like crude oil or asphalt. Its substantial carbon written content and low sulfur content allow it to be notably precious in quite a few industrial purposes.

Certainly one of the main makes use of of asphaltite is in street building. As opposed to traditional asphalt, which can be derived from refining crude oil, asphaltite gives a By natural means happening binder for pavements. Its durability and resistance to deformation less than superior temperatures help it become ideal for highways, airport runways, and industrial flooring. In addition, asphaltite is used in production electrodes, waterproofing components, as well as as a gasoline in a few energy output processes.

The mining of asphaltite calls for cautious extraction techniques. It generally occurs in veins or deposits in just sedimentary rocks. Mining operations must harmony efficiency with environmental things to consider, making certain negligible impact on bordering ecosystems whilst maximizing useful resource recovery.

Gilsonite

Gilsonite is an additional method of normal asphalt, intently linked to asphaltite, but with one of a kind industrial significance. It can be discovered principally in the United States, notably in Utah, and is frequently generally known as “uintaite” in particular areas. Gilsonite is shiny, black, and brittle, with superior carbon material, which makes it highly combustible.

Gilsonite’s programs lengthen outside of design. It's commonly Employed in the creation of inks, paints, and coatings because of its binding Homes. Its capacity to adhere perfectly to surfaces and resist h2o makes it ideal for specialty goods including printing inks, asphalt modifiers, and foundry sand binders. Also, gilsonite is Employed in the oil and fuel marketplace as being a drilling additive to improve the efficiency of drilling fluids.

The extraction of gilsonite requires the two surface area and underground mining. Surface area mining is frequent the place deposits are in close proximity to the ground, although underground mining is employed for deeper veins. The mining process must think about each safety and environmental impact, as gilsonite is very flammable and might release dangerous fumes if improperly handled.

Graphite and Grafito

Graphite, known as grafito in Spanish, is usually a The natural way transpiring kind of crystalline carbon. It really is renowned for its distinctive Attributes, which include substantial thermal and electrical conductivity, chemical inertness, and lubricating capacity. Graphite is soft, slippery, and metallic grey in physical appearance, making it functional for numerous industrial purposes.

Among the most familiar takes advantage of of graphite is in pencils, the place it serves because the crafting core. Outside of stationery, graphite is vital in industries which include steel production, the place it is applied as being a refractory substance, and within the production of batteries, particularly lithium-ion batteries, which electricity electric powered automobiles and transportable electronics. Graphite also finds applications in lubricants, brake linings, and significant-temperature crucibles because of its resistance to heat and chemical assault.

Mining graphite will involve extracting the mineral from metamorphic rocks exactly where it Obviously takes place in veins or levels. Each open-pit and underground mining methods are utilised, based on the deposit depth and geography. Environmental management is critical through graphite mining, as dust technology and chemical use can impact neighborhood ecosystems.

Limestone and Caliza

Limestone, or caliza in Spanish, can be a sedimentary rock principally made up of calcium carbonate (CaCO₃). It sorts over countless a long time through the accumulation of shells, coral, together with other maritime organisms. Limestone is considerable and has long been a cornerstone of design and producing for hundreds of years.

In development, limestone can be a essential ingredient in cement and concrete, supplying strength and durability to buildings. It is additionally employed for street base product, dimension stone in properties, and ornamental stonework. Industrially, limestone serves in steel producing for a flux to get rid of impurities, in glass manufacturing, As well as in chemical procedures such as the creation of lime and calcium carbonate powders.

Limestone mining is usually carried out through open up-pit strategies, which allow for that productive extraction of large portions of rock. The environmental impacts contain landscape alteration, dust emissions, and possible h2o contamination, that happen to be managed via rehabilitation, dust suppression, and h2o remedy systems.

Mining (Minería)

The extraction of pure sources like asphaltite, gilsonite, graphite, and limestone is created possible by mining, or minería in Spanish. Mining may be the spine of modern sector, supplying Uncooked materials essential for development, Power, technological know-how, and manufacturing.

Modern-day mining encompasses various tactics, including surface area mining, underground mining, and Option mining, according to the mineral form, deposit size, and location. Mining operations are ever more guided by environmental and social obligation requirements, emphasizing sustainable extraction, worker basic safety, and small ecological impact.

Technological breakthroughs have improved mining effectiveness and minimized environmental footprints. Automation, distant-managed machines, and geological surveying enhance precision in mineral extraction. Furthermore, rehabilitation packages and recycling initiatives are built-in to restore mined regions and lower useful resource depletion.

Mining not simply contributes to industrial source chains but will also significantly impacts local economies. Work opportunities, infrastructure development, and technological innovation often accompany mining projects. Nevertheless, balancing financial Gains with ecological preservation continues to be a important problem.
